There Was Silence Poem by A. E Loewer

There Was Silence

Rating: 3.5


There was silence
in my heart
And for a moment

It did not restart

that moment




Was eternity,
not real
And for that moment
I wished not to feel

Though time moved forward
There I stayed
In that moment


Life delayed
